A corporation is not a suitable person to hold a licence if an executive officer of the corporation—
(a) has been convicted or found guilty within the previous 5 years of an offence involving drugs that is prescribed under the regulations; or
(b) is affected by bankruptcy action; or
(c) is someone the chief executive decides under section 17 (Consideration of suitability of applicant or licensee) is not a suitable person to hold a licence.
